linux - 从 Marathon 中销毁应用程序会将其放入部署中。如何在马拉松比赛中销毁应用程序?

标签 linux devops mesos marathon mesosphere

我正在尝试销毁我使用 marathon 框架部署的示例应用程序。现在我正试图销毁该应用程序,但不幸的是,由于某种原因我无法销毁它们。

我已经试过了:

  1. 在我的奴隶上重新启动马拉松服务。
  2. 重新启动 mesos-manager。
  3. 重新启动 mesos-master。
  4. 检查它们之间是否正确连接。

为什么当我销毁应用程序时它会进入部署模式? 现在有什么办法可以销毁这个应用程序吗? 我得到的错误如下,

  1. 销毁应用程序时 销毁应用程序时出错 销毁 null 时出错:App '/null' 不存在

  2. 生成新应用 应用程序被一个或多个部署锁定。使用选项“?force=true”覆盖。在“/v2/deployments/”查看详细信息

最佳答案

刚试过

  1. 重新启动 mesos-master
  2. 重新启动 mesos-slave
  3. 清除了 mesos-zookeeper 的缓存
  4. 进入 mesos-manager docker 镜像并重新启动所有服务。

其中一个一定会起作用

关于linux - 从 Marathon 中销毁应用程序会将其放入部署中。如何在马拉松比赛中销毁应用程序?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/44978181/

相关文章:

linux - 如何在 Linux 中通过 USB-to-RS232 线与设备通信?

docker - kubernetes将传出的http流量从服务重定向到localhost:port

Apache 计时码 : how to access web ui

mesos - 马拉松 vs 极光及其目的

django - 使用 fpm 制作 deb 包时设置自定义安装目录

haproxy - 如何编写mesos和HAProxy进程的prometheus警报规则?

linux - 如果需要,如何创建和应用补丁文件,跳过文件版本?

linux - O_SYNC 写入何时在页面缓存(mmap 文件)中可见?

linux - 使用 Linux/Bash 对空格分隔的数字进行排序

azure - 我想使用 Azure 管道任务发送带有附件的电子邮件